Description: Justinmind is a prototyping and wireframing tool used to design and prototype user interfaces for web and mobile apps. It allows designers and developers to quickly create interactive prototypes without coding.

Description: Wondershare Mockitt is a user interface and prototype design tool that allows you to quickly create mockups, wireframes and prototypes for web and mobile apps. It has a simple and intuitive drag-and-drop interface with various preset components like buttons, forms, menus etc. that you can use to design the UI.

Pros & Cons Analysis

Justinmind
Justinmind
Pros
  • Easy to learn and use
  • Good for rapid prototyping
  • Allows collaboration between team members
  • Has many interaction and animation options
  • Supports high and low fidelity prototyping
Cons
  • Can be pricey for some teams
  • Lacks some advanced design features
  • Prototypes may not be 100% accurate to final product
  • Steep learning curve for advanced features
Wondershare Mockitt
Wondershare Mockitt
Pros
  • Simple and intuitive user interface
  • Wide range of UI components
  • Supports real-time collaboration
  • Responsive design capabilities
  • Ability to add interactivity to prototypes
Cons
  • Limited animation options
  • Occasional performance issues with larger projects
  • Limited integration with other design tools
